Public Broadcasting Fee: When the pursuit of warfare shreds very important debate

April 26, 2026
Public Broadcasting Fee: When the pursuit of warfare shreds very important debate
SHARE

For months, the parliamentary committee on public broadcasting has provoked a demanding and perplexed change of hands between its rapporteur, Charles Aloncl, a Ciotista MP with regards to Jordan Bardella, and the ones accountable and tv stars. What are we able to be told from this fee, in the case of shape and content material?

The functioning of the parliamentary fee for public broadcasting used to be ordinary till its finish. Certainly, on April 27, 2026, in the back of closed doorways, the 31 MPs who make up it’s going to need to vote by means of a easy majority on whether or not or to not submit the file, after having had the fitting to learn it below strict prerequisites of confidentiality. A process foreseen by means of the texts and which just about by no means ends up in the rejection of e-newsletter. However this time uncertainty reigns.

The reporter, Charles Alloncle (Regulation Union for the Republic, a bunch created below the management of Eric Ciotti), already reported in February “risks” that his file could be buried. The opinion stemmed from a lot of tensions between him and President Jérémy Patria-Laytus (Horizon staff) and grievance from different participants in regards to the manner hearings had been carried out, incessantly in a quite heated method.

And the participants of the fee are conscious that they’re going through a lure nowadays. In the event that they make a selection to vote towards the discharge of the file, it will permit its rapporteur to undertake a flattering stance of victimization, the stance of a person we wish to silence as a result of it will no longer be just right to inform the entire reality in relation to public broadcasting. If they permit it to be printed, they’re de facto supporting the very contentious habits of the listening to.

So let’s get again to the teachings we will be told from this arguable collection.

Alloncle breaks with parliamentary conventions

The reporter took a stand towards the general public provider, with a populist undertone, emphasizing prices that may be unjustified, scenarios introduced as offensive, feedback made in utterly other contexts that may be scandalous. This shut pal of Jordan Bardella, nonetheless little or no recognized, is bold, and what higher strategy to ruin the media glass ceiling than to shake up the audiovisual stars, giving the sensation that he’s taking part in on a fair footing, and he’s best profiting from borrowed repute?

A ways from the inflexible tone that befits this type of gadget, the repeated arguments between the president and the reporter (once in a while to the purpose of interrupting the paintings or with the interviewees), seemed like introducing a tradition of warfare into the hemicycle. Additionally, Charles Aloncl often reported on those additions of guns, in a self-promotional common sense, thru worried montages on his social networks, and no longer all the time with impeccable truthfulness. Radio France leader govt Sybil Manner additionally wrote a letter to the fee’s president to sentence what she described as a “public distortion” of his feedback. Host Samuel Etienne additionally complained overtly, charging that the seek for buzz became on-line harassment.

On this judgment sport, the dominant feeling for everybody, each observers and parliamentarians, is confusion, between “bloodshed, lies and heated debates”. The debates are carried out in a perfect mixture of genres, the place accounting is blended (once in a while misunderstood) with condemnations of comedians’ feedback, associated with the evaluate of salaries or nominative insurance policies of very well-known folks, or with judgments which might be as political as they’re derogatory.

So what are we able to be told from the 67 hearings and the responses of the 234 interviewees?

Responses of the interviewees to the accusations

Relating to knowledge processing, from the overall director of France TV to the reporters concerned, everybody labored to reaffirm the significance of pluralism and the stability wanted for public media. Thus, when a reporter puzzled the editorial possible choices of the Supplement d’investigation program, its editor-in-chief recalled: “In five seasons we have made ten political portraits and we are in perfect equality. We have worked with Jean-Luc Mélenchon, Sofia Chiquira, Sandrine Russo, Ana Alex, Ana Alex, Ana Hidalgo. Eric Dupont-Moretti, Rashida Dutti, Eric Zemur and Jordan Bardella”, so “as many people on the left as on the right (and) as many in center”.

As for positive disasters at the air (Gaza, as an example, described as a imaginable Riviera), which the fee remembered, it must be famous that each one circumstances have already been resolved internally, with sanctions.

A number of the demanding conversations, Lea Salame controlled to argue that the girl used to be no longer obliged to suppose like her husband and pay attention to him (“No one could ever hear that my companion or anyone else was holding my pen”) and that she undertook (no longer below power, however as a moral evidence for her and her editorial crew) to droop her paintings at 8 p.m. presentation on whether or not her spouse, Rafael Glucksman, used to be a candidate for the 2027 presidential election (“If he’s a candidate, I’m going off the air”).

On accounting and fiscal problems, the debates and battles had been both extremely technical or extremely polarized, with everybody sticking to their positions. We remember the fact that the Courtroom of Auditors’ 2025 file, which is incessantly cited, has recognized issues and tactics to make stronger. On the other hand, rapporteur Alloncle used to be contradicted a number of occasions when he spoke of the “near bankruptcy” of public broadcasting because of mismanagement. His interlocutors pointed to repeated and quite harsh finances restrictions that specifically threatened operating capital.

The standing of the Mediavan manufacturing corporate has additionally been a lot debated, with knowledge produced by means of its managers indicating that it used to be certainly a predominantly French corporate, opposite to the reporter’s repeated suspicions. The presentation of the contracts concluded with the primary manufacturing properties as “friendly agreements” used to be put into standpoint by means of the manufacturing of inner knowledge indicating that the proportion of those contracts within the general turnover of those firms didn’t let them be “devoured” on the expense of the general public provider.

The reporter decried “cocktail and reception costs” of just about 1,000,000 euros in 2020. The phrase cocktail smacks of mismanagement by means of impolite elites because the French tighten their belts. On the other hand, those had been meal and “food shopping” prices meant for all staff, irrespective of standing, operating whilst the crowd’s canteens had been closed because of Covid-19.

We’re due to this fact resulted in suppose that the will to regard, in a perfect undifferentiated complete, such a lot of other topics, as has been justified from the start of the paintings, can best result in this disjointed and perplexed patchwork. A ways from protecting an actual counter-project to public broadcasting, what in the end emerges from these kind of moments of hysteria is that the fee, and particularly its rapporteur, adopted the instance of quite a lot of examples, pointing to info that had been already recognized or dropped at gentle by means of different government, in an effort to give credence to the preconceived concept that the entirety used to be happening. As though actually the function used to be to select on the construction right here and there. Positive court cases (expanding taxi prices, revolving door of licensees to manufacturing firms operating for France TV, incomplete growth of analytical accounting, and so forth.) could have if truth be told led the interviewees to difficulties.

In spite of everything, we now have the impact that the debates and assaults of this fee had been meant to solid doubt on public broadcasting in an effort to indubitably get ready folks’s minds, at some point, to just accept its privatization or the closure of a number of of its branches.
